Beverly Ann Roy Pospisil

July 29, 1937 ~ September 19, 2011

Beverly Ann Hatzky Roy Pospisil, 74, died Monday, September 19, 2011, in her Sutliff home due to complications of cancer. Beverly's viewing and visitation will be 10:00 a.m., until twelve noon Friday, at Morgan Funeral Choices, Mount Vernon. Graveside services 2:00 p.m., Friday at Sulek Cemetery rural Shueyville by Celebrant Mary Morgan. Surviving Bev are her husband George; son Blade Roy of Cedar Rapids; step-sons: Brad Pospisil, Portland Oregon and Harley Pospisil, Troy, Missouri; four grandchildren: Jared Roy, Justin, Jessica, and Rachel Pospisil; and a sister Sharon (Richard) Hill of Angel Fire, New Mexico. Preceding Bev in death were her parents and her brother Roger Hatzky. Bev was born July 29, 1937, in Elma, Iowa, the daughter of Alfred "Bud" and Dorothy Manning Hatzky. She graduated from Colwell High School. Bev had various vocations through life, working at Life Investors Insurance, Collins Radio, Wilson Meat Packing Company, and retiring from McVay's Construction all of Cedar Rapids. She enjoyed the playing cards and trying her luck at the casinos.
